2009-12-17 5 views
0

J'essaie d'obtenir une ligne de code dans mon application ASP.net (en utilisant Visual Studio) pour apparaître dans une fenêtre Jquery "Fancybox". Je sais comment le faire avec un lien href régulier. Cependant, je suis confus sur la façon de configurer cela en utilisant un généré dynamiquement.Utilisation de Fancybox (plugin jquery) dans ASP.net

Voici mon ligne de code que je voudrais appeler Jquery:

<asp:HyperLink ID="hypPrint" style="margin-left: 5px;" CssClass="btn3" runat="server" Text="View/Print" CausesValidation="false" /> 

Si je vais dans mon dossier CS et rechercher hypPrint, voici ce qu'il est défini comme: (e.Row.FindControl ("hypPrint") comme HyperLink) .NavigateUrl = "PrintTicket.aspx? ticketid =" + id;

Fondamentalement, je dois avoir cet appel hypertexte un ID défini pour fancybox, appelé dans la tête. J'apprécierais toute aide que n'importe quels experts d'ASP.Net peuvent me fournir!

+0

Je ne suis pas sûr de ce que vous essayez de faire ici. Avez-vous besoin d'aide pour câbler l'événement click? –

Répondre

-1

La façon rapide et sale de le faire serait d'utiliser l'attribut « classe » comme le sélecteur pour le plugin fancybox:

$('.btn3').fancybox(); 

Honnêtement, bien que, je ferais une classe plus descriptive et l'utilisation au lieu de cela, mais ce débat appartient ailleurs. Cela devrait faire l'affaire pour vous.

Questions connexes